Output 59410194990d6426c92a544f149b83287077700057f59892f7936ec01184e419:1

value
28700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2e771cf268342025fa14a990e037f20be64a8b4 OP_EQUALVERIFY OP_CHECKSIG
address
1JmZMGQHt3EPaJuqtiK8wijpjLzLFtYfMG
transaction
59410194990d6426c92a544f149b83287077700057f59892f7936ec01184e419
spent
true